How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Northwestern Queens?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Northwestern Queens Studio Apartments | $3,500 | $1,400 | $5,586 |
Northwestern Queens 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,148 | $1,300 | $8,020 |
| Northwestern Queens 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,773 | $2,200 | $8,700 |
| Northwestern Queens 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,796 | $3,250 | $10,000+ |
| Northwestern Queens 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,800 | $3,600 | $4,000 |
